Chinese Jumping Mouse
Fossil range: Late Miocene - Recent
Conservation status
Scientific classification
Kingdom: Animalia
Phylum: Chordata
Class: Mammalia
Order: Rodentia
Family: Dipodidae
Subfamily: Zapodinae
Genus: Eozapus
Preble, 1899
Species: E. setchuanus
Binomial name
Eozapus setchuanus
(Pousargues, 1896)

The Chinese Jumping Mouse (Eozapus setchuanus) is a species of rodent in the Dipodidae family. It is monotypic within the genus Eozapus. It is endemic to China. Its natural habitat is temperate forests. It is threatened by habitat loss.
